Output df328e3f35ef3eea198ca72b9a36524a8a9a031f63fbcab53779d1126f2312bb:0

value
17488870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5245c611ae6347e83e920244bf634381b0307389 OP_EQUAL
address
39C2vEeEHAZB2t8QiRMkvip4Db615U2sGG
transaction
df328e3f35ef3eea198ca72b9a36524a8a9a031f63fbcab53779d1126f2312bb
confirmations
266593
spent
true